basic FUNCTION
| increasing the catalytic rate of RNA polymerase II transcription by suppressing transient pausing by the polymerase at multiple sites along the DNA |
|
indirectly modulates transcription by serving as a regulator for transcriptional elongation as well as for TP53, EAF2, and steroid receptor activities (Zhou 2009) |
|
could modulate THBS1 promoter activity in a direct manner and could indeed serve as a transcriptional factor to regulate its expression (Zhou 2009) |
|
influences vasculogenesis, at least in part, through up-regulating THBS1 (Zhou 2009) |
|
has an early and essential role during rapid high-amplitude gene expression that is required for both Pol II pause site entry and release |
|
in addition to its association within super elongation complex (SEC), is also a component of the little elongation complex (LEC) involved in small nuclear RNA (snRNA) gene expression in ES cells |
|
is recruited to UV-damaged chromatin in a CDK7- dependent manner |
|
is essential for transcription resumption after removal of transcription blocking DNA lesions by the transcription-coupled repair (TCR) machinery |
|
ELL and CDK7 play essential yet distinct roles during transcription-coupled repair (TCR) |
|
role of ELL in response to DNA damage, providing an insight into the mechanism for KMT2A-ELL-associated leukemogenesis |
